Job Description
To provide primary health care services to children, teens, young adults, and their families, including health promotion and interdisciplinary collaboration.
- Health maintenance, developmental screen, depression screen, immunizations, lab works, age-appropriate anticipatory guidance, preventive counseling, checking labs, discuss results with parents and or patients.
- Should have 2 years of minimum EPIC EMR experience
- Must have 2 years of Pediatrics experience as a Pediatrics Nurse Practitioner.
- Should be able to see 25+ patients/per day.
- Should be able to close the chart in 24 hours.
- Sick visits, follow-ups, checking labs, checking patient messages, and writing prescriptions.
- Newborn visits, hospital discharge follow-up, breastfeeding services. Facilitate Direct admission to the hospital if necessary.
- A Simple procedure like Nebulizer treatment, PFT, nasopharyngeal swabs, immunization, TB test, stitches, Wart removal, cryo, cauterization, and staple removal.
- Referral to pediatrics subspecialties, and direct communications with the specialist if necessary.
